Section 1: Who Are Crypto Market Makers?

1.1 Definition and Background

Crypto market makers are entities or individuals who provide liquidity to the crypto market by constantly buying and selling digital assets. They are crucial in ensuring that there is a continuous flow of trades, which is essential for the market's stability and growth.

1.2 Types of Crypto Market Makers

1.2.1 Institutional Market Makers

Institutional market makers are typically large financial institutions, hedge funds, and other institutional investors that have the capital and expertise to trade large volumes of cryptocurrencies.

1.2.2 Retail Market Makers

Retail market makers are individuals or small firms that provide liquidity to the market by trading smaller volumes of cryptocurrencies.

1.2.3 High-Frequency Traders (HFTs)

High-frequency traders are a subset of retail market makers that use sophisticated algorithms to execute trades at incredibly high speeds, often several times per second.

Section 2: Functions of Crypto Market Makers

2.1 Providing Liquidity

One of the primary functions of crypto market makers is to provide liquidity. By continuously buying and selling digital assets, they ensure that there is a market for buyers and sellers, allowing for smooth trading.

2.2 Ensuring Market Stability

Crypto market makers play a crucial role in maintaining market stability. By providing liquidity and absorbing large orders, they help prevent sharp price fluctuations and volatility.

2.3 Facilitating Arbitrage Opportunities

Crypto market makers also facilitate arbitrage opportunities by exploiting price discrepancies across different exchanges. This helps in maintaining fair and consistent prices across the market.

2.4 Enhancing Market Depth

Market depth refers to the total volume of buy and sell orders at various price levels. Crypto market makers contribute to the market depth by placing limit orders at various price levels, allowing for more significant trading volumes.

Section 3: Impact of Crypto Market Makers on the Crypto Market

3.1 Price Stability

Crypto market makers contribute to price stability by absorbing large orders and providing liquidity. This helps in reducing volatility and preventing extreme price movements.

3.2 Increased Market Participation

By providing liquidity, crypto market makers attract more traders and investors to the market, thereby increasing market participation and overall trading volumes.

3.3 Improved Trading Experience

The presence of crypto market makers ensures a smooth trading experience for retail investors. With continuous liquidity and reduced volatility, traders can execute their orders without worrying about significant price fluctuations.

3.4 Enhanced Market Efficiency

Crypto market makers play a crucial role in enhancing market efficiency by reducing bid-ask spreads. This allows for fairer pricing and better execution of trades.

Section 4: Challenges Faced by Crypto Market Makers

4.1 Market Volatility

The highly volatile nature of the crypto market poses a significant challenge for crypto market makers. They need to constantly monitor and adjust their strategies to cope with sudden price changes.

4.2 Regulatory Environment

The evolving regulatory landscape can be challenging for crypto market makers. They need to stay updated with the latest regulations and adapt their operations accordingly.

4.3 High Capital Requirements

Crypto market makers require substantial capital to operate effectively. The high capital requirements can be a barrier for new entrants and small-scale market makers.

4.4 Competition

The crypto market is becoming increasingly competitive, with more market makers entering the space. This competition can lead to reduced profit margins and market share.
